Job Description

HPC Development Engineer designing and supporting CIQ’s enterprise Linux, cloud, and HPC infrastructure. Developing Go-based solutions, improving system performance, and guiding architecture and deployments.

Responsibilities:

  • Design, develop, and support enterprise solutions, products, and infrastructure for CIQ.
  • Maintain systems’ capacity and performance.
  • Troubleshoot and improve applications and processes.
  • Analyze current code and industry developments to design engineering solutions.
  • Lead and participate in architecture-level discussions, planning, and implementation.
  • Research optimal technical approaches.
  • Document projects to share knowledge and facilitate user integration.
  • Drive proofs of concept and minimal viable products for demonstrations.
  • Support services before launch through system design consulting, software platform and framework development, capacity planning, and launch reviews.
  • Collaborate with Engineering, Product, Sales, and open-source communities on relevant solutions while sharing knowledge.
  • Design and guide solutions for ambiguous requirements.

Requirements:

  • Understanding of Linux and cloud infrastructure.
  • Extensive experience with GoLang, Pulumi, Kubernetes, and other engineering tools/technologies.
  • Ability to pivot to new challenges in a fast-paced startup environment.
  • Expertise in deriving solutions from high-level or incomplete requirements.
  • Strong problem-solving skills and eagerness to learn.
  • Excellent verbal and written communication skills.
  • Ability to work independently and collaboratively in a remote team environment.
  • Flexibility to support an on-call rotation.
  • Bachelor’s degree in Computer Science or a similar field.
  • At least 10 years of experience writing software in Go, Python, Scala, etc.
  • Demonstrated mastery of Linux and cloud (AWS/Azure/GCP).
  • High-performance or scientific computing experience is a plus.
